Vue3基础知识点文档
1.基础属性: reactive, computed, watchEffect, watch, onMounted,getCurrentInstance
/*
说明:
1.setup是函数入口
2.getCurrentInstance全局函数,可以绑定全局方法
3.reactive 声明变量
let state = reactive({ name: "summer" })
return { state }
页面使用: {
{ state.name }}
简写方式: 在return里面采用 return { ...toRefs(state) }
页面使用: {
{ name }}
4.computed-计算属性 let num = computed(() => { state.name = "zero" })
5.watch-监听属性
6.watchEffect
*/
<template>
<div class="box">
{
{ state.name }}---{
{ state.num }}
<h1>
<test-son :list="state.list"></test-son>
</h1>
<h2>年龄总和: {
{ total }}</h2>
<div @click="handleClick">点击</div>
</d